What Causes Lithium Golf Cart Batteries to Catch Fire?

There are several factors that can lead to a fire with lithium-ion batteries. Here are the main causes:

  • Overcharging: Overcharging is one of the most common reasons for battery fires. If the battery is left connected to a charger for too long or the charging system malfunctions, the battery may overheat, leading to thermal runaway—a dangerous condition that can result in a fire.
  • Physical Damage: If a lithium-ion battery is physically damaged, such as by a puncture, it can create a short circuit inside the battery, potentially leading to a fire. Dropping or striking the battery can cause internal damage that isn’t immediately visible.
  • Defective Battery Cells: Manufacturing defects in lithium-ion batteries, such as faulty cells, can cause malfunctions, leading to overheating and fires. It's essential to buy batteries from reputable sources to reduce the likelihood of defective products.
  • Improper Disposal: Improperly discarding a lithium battery, such as throwing it in a fire or recycling bin, can cause it to catch fire. Batteries should always be disposed of according to local regulations and in a safe manner to prevent accidents.
  • Charging in High Temperatures: Charging lithium-ion batteries in excessively hot environments can increase the risk of fire. High temperatures can cause the battery to overheat, triggering thermal runaway. It's important to charge batteries in a cool, dry place to reduce this risk.

Is It Common for Lithium Batteries to Catch Fire?

While the risk of lithium battery fires exists, it is not common. Modern lithium-ion batteries are designed with numerous safeguards to prevent overheating and fires. In fact, the occurrence of fires is relatively rare compared to the widespread use of lithium-ion batteries in everyday devices, including smartphones, laptops, and golf carts. Most manufacturers implement safety features, such as battery management systems (BMS), which monitor voltage, current, and temperature to protect the battery from dangerous conditions.

That said, the overall safety of lithium batteries depends on how they are used, charged, and maintained. With proper care and attention, the risk of a fire can be minimized significantly.

How to Avoid a Lithium-Ion Battery Fire?

There are several steps that golf cart owners can take to ensure their lithium batteries remain safe and do not pose a fire hazard:

  • Use a Quality Charger: Always use the charger that is recommended by the manufacturer for your lithium battery. Using an incompatible charger can lead to overcharging or inefficient charging, increasing the risk of overheating.
  • Avoid Overcharging: Never leave your lithium battery charging for extended periods beyond the recommended time. Many modern chargers will automatically shut off when the battery is fully charged, but it's still essential to monitor the process to avoid overcharging.
  • Regularly Inspect the Battery: Check your golf cart battery for signs of physical damage, such as bulges, cracks, or leaks. If you notice any of these issues, stop using the battery immediately and consult a professional for replacement or repair.
  • Charge in a Safe Location: Charge your golf cart battery in a cool, dry, and well-ventilated area. Avoid charging in direct sunlight or in places with high ambient temperatures, as heat can increase the risk of a fire.
  • Never Expose the Battery to Extreme Temperatures: Avoid exposing your golf cart to extreme hot or cold temperatures, as this can degrade the battery's performance and safety. Store your battery in a temperature-controlled environment when not in use.

What to Do If Your Battery Overheats

If you suspect that your lithium golf cart battery is overheating or showing signs of malfunction, take the following steps immediately:

  • Disconnect the Power: If safe to do so, turn off the power and disconnect the battery from the charger or the golf cart.
  • Move to a Safe Location: If the battery is smoking or has visible signs of damage, move the golf cart to a safe, well-ventilated area away from flammable materials.
  • Call for Help: If the situation worsens or if you are unsure of how to handle it, contact emergency services or a professional technician for assistance.
